Description
In the summer of 1967, an abnormally high mortality rate struck the Portuguese oysters, Crassostrea angulata, of the Marennes and Arcachon sites and, less severely, those of the other farming sectors of the French Atlantic coast. Yet the examinations performed in the preceding months had brought to light the existence of rather deep lesions on the gills and sometimes on the labial palpi of a large number of the species' oysters that were not harbouring any pinnotheres. The successive appearance of the two phenomena led us to attribute the observed mortalities to what we have called, for convenience, "gill disease". The various specialised laboratories of the Institute of Fishing strove to determine the nature of the infection, its distribution in France and abroad where oyster farmers lay in supplies, its frequency and its development. They have attempted, moreover, just as others have done here and there, to identify the responsible organism or organisms. It seemed appropriate to introduce the current state of our observations and to publish the preliminary results of the research undertaken in the laboratories of the Institute of Fishing.
